Plaid Friday in Alexandria Offers Deals After Thanksgiving

The discounts Alexandria businesses will offer on November 24 are worth getting up early for.

By Colleen Kelleher November 10, 2023 at 11:20 am

More than 50 businesses in Del Ray and Old Town Alexandria will take part in Alexandria’s version of Black Friday, called Plaid Friday.

Get up early and grab a cup of coffee at one of the coffee shops that will open at 6 a.m. — then start shopping.

Some of the stores open at 6 a.m. and will offer 30 percent discounts between 6 a.m. and 8 a.m.

There will be 20 percent off between 8 a.m. and 10 a.m. From 10 a.m. until closing, you can get 10 percent off your purchases.

For those getting ready for the holidays, you’ll have a nice selection of gift options. The participating stores range from home décor to couture handbags to gourmet foods to handcrafted items at the Torpedo Factory. In addition to boutiques that sell chic and name brand clothing, some of Alexandria’s consignment shops will offer deals.

For those looking to buy gift cards, Sugar House Day Spa and Salon will offer 10 percent off gift cards. The Tea and Spice Exchange also has free gift cards, depending on how much you spend.

The idea behind Plaid Friday, which started in Oakland, California, started as a way to weave “the individual threads of small businesses together to create a strong fabric that celebrates the diversity and creativity of independent businesses,” said a news release from Old Town Business.
